Als Ultraschall bezeichnet man Schall mit Frequenzen oberhalb des Hörfrequenzbereichs des Menschen. Er umfasst Frequenzen ab etwa 16 kHz. Schall ab einer Frequenz von etwa 1 GHz wird auch als Hyperschall bezeichnet. Bei Frequenzen unterhalb des für Menschen hörbaren Frequenzbereichs spricht man dagegen von Infraschall.
